Add 5/42 and 81/70

1st number: 5/42, 2nd number: 1 11/70

5/42 + 81/70 is 134/105.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 42 and 70 is 210

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 210
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 42 × 5 = 210,
    5/42 = 5 × 5/42 × 5 = 25/210
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 70 × 3 = 210,
    81/70 = 81 × 3/70 × 3 = 243/210
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    25/210 + 243/210 = 25 + 243/210 = 268/210
  5. 268/210 simplified gives 134/105
  6. So, 5/42 + 81/70 = 134/105
